Antonis Stroggylakis is a journalist at Euroleague Basketball. He covers a range of topics related to basketball, with a particular focus on Euroleague events and player insights. Antonis has been featured in Eurohoops, showcasing his expertise and passion for the sport.

Antonis Stroggylakis' coverage is primarily focused on basketball, with a specific emphasis on EuroLeague and international basketball players. To effectively reach out to him, consider offering insights or exclusive interviews related to ongoing events in the world of basketball, particularly those involving EuroLeague teams and players.

Given his focus on event coverage and evolving stories within the realm of sports, pitches should highlight any breaking news or provide unique perspectives related to EuroLeague matches, prominent basketball figures, or significant developments within the sport.

Stroggylakis appears to have a broad interest in international basketball as well as individual player performances across different leagues. Therefore, providing expert commentary from coaches, players, or analysts involved in these areas could be particularly appealing for potential outreach efforts.
